hello i viewed a forum regarding the 2” narrow adjustible beam.
it stated with i’m lost. i’ve replaced every thing on my rig.
new thing 2” narrow beam, tie rods, ball joints, drum brakes to disc brakes (front and rear) shocks all around, torsion bar steering gear box. i mean everything!

and i have the same problem, with the car on the ground i have no front end suspension feels like it’s sitting rigid. no adjustment. please let me know if you have experienced this and what would be the correction???

What height is the beam set to? If it’s low the ball joints run out of travel.
With the arms fitted without spindles could you smoothly rotate them against the spring (or could they be binding)?

Does your beam have urethane bushings, or bearings?

Does it smoothly cycle with the spring packs removed?

Are the adjusters set properly to not fight one spring pack against the other?
